Change the Lamp in a Sony LCD TV


When the images on your screen become dark, distorted and miscolored, your Sony TV lamp likely is damaged and in need of a repair. The cause may be overuse, a short circuit or a power surge. Replacing your Sony LCD lamp is a short process that you can perform yourself, avoiding the cost of a technician.


Instructions


Removing the Old Lamp


1. Unplug your TV, then let it cool down for at least 30 minutes. Unscrew your lamp connector from the back of the TV. Remove the two screws holding the silver metal clips on the lamp connector using your Phillips screwdriver. Depending on the model of your Sony TV, the lamp connector is located on the lower right or left corner on the back of your TV.


2. Pull the metal clips gently from the lamp connector, then push the plastic thorns on the side of the lamp connector with a flat-head screwdriver to loosen the plastic cover.


3. Remove the plastic cover. Take off the double headed metal spring on the lamp enclosure, keeping in mind the angle and position for when you place it back.


4. Remove the screw on the top of the connectors with your Phillips head, then remove the plastic cover by lifting the connector and pulling it back to detach completely.


5. After unscrewing the metal clips holding it, remove the old lamp. The bulb is blown when the filament is broken.


6. Loosen and remove the screws on the connectors attached to the back of the lamp. Keep in mind the angle and positioning of the connectors when attaching the new lamp.


7. Use pliers to pull off the bolt on the connector located on the center of the old bulb and then detach it.


Replacing the New Bulb


8. Attach the connectors to the new lamp, screwing them in gently. Handle the bulb carefully to avoid piercing it as you attach the screws.


9. Place the lamp back in the lamp enclosure, then screw the clips back on. Place the lamp enclosure with the new bulb into the plastic connector, then replace the cover.


10. Screw the cover tightly onto the lamp connector. Put the double headed spring gently back into its compartment. Push it down onto its hole as you push the plastic cover over.


11. Place the metal clips back to the side of the plastic lamp connector, then screw them tightly. Screw the lamp connector back into the TV.
